  • Dedon "Obelisk" Garden Furniture
    By DEDON, Frank Ligthart
    Located in Hanover, MA
    BG GALLERIES SALE PRICE THROUGH 30 April 2024 The Obelisk designed by Frank Ligthart for Dedon, 2008. No longer in production. It is composed of two pairs of matching high- and low-back chairs and a conical table. The base of the table supports all the chairs when stacked into its sculptural shape for storage. We also have available separately a near complete additional Obelisk consisting of three of the S chairs and one M chair plus the table. Image 9 shows the complete Obelisk plus the spare table and chairs. Best of both worlds is to have the spare set for seating together with the complete Obelisk as sculpture, until additional seating is required. Image 8 shows the "spare" set which includes 3 "S" chairs (instead of 2) and 1 "M" chair (instead of 2) and one table base. The discounted price for the spare set on its own is $3800. The spare set will not stack to form the obelisk because that requires two of each chair. This is the ultra-chic original space-saving solution for garden, pool or terrace furniture...

  • Antique American Railroad Track Switch Target Sign
    Located in Forney, TX
    An antique American railroad yard switch sign on custom stand. A wonderful example of both Americana and industrial folk art! Born in the US in the early 20th century, the large, double sided, painted red iron circular disc shaped "target" sign; mounted to painted black cast iron central pedestal standard; surmounted by hand hammered and chiseled raw iron three inch tall finial; rising from a later five spoke pentagonal black iron base, elaborately shaped, fan form with niche curved flowing lines. The central standard can unscrew from the base for easy transportation and storage. Versatile, use it indoors as a decorative accent and quick way to add color, rustic texture, dimension, and interest, or use outdoors to brighten up your space as a garden ornament or statue. Original condition but we mildly sealed it to preserve the beautiful, warm rustic patina that enhances it so much. Now stable, it won't make a mess or deteriorate, while retaining the unique character and charm that can only be aquired from decades of use, being weathered, naturally distressed, with old chippy paint, that's elegantly aged, rich deep red color It is a full size, authentic railroad iron target...
